SaltStack安装部署
SaltStack安装部署
安装:
一. master:
1. 配置yum源安装
# rpm --import https://repo.saltstack.com/yum/redhat/6/x86_64/latest/SALTSTACK-GPG-KEY.pub #载入yum认证文件
# cd /etc/yum.repos.d/
# vim saltstack.repo
[saltstack-repo]
name=SaltStack repo for RHEL/CentOS $releasever
baseurl=https://repo.saltstack.com/yum/redhat/$releasever/$basearch/latest
enabled=
gpgcheck=
gpgkey=https://repo.saltstack.com/yum/redhat/$releasever/$basearch/latest/SALTSTACK-GPG-KEY.pub # yum clean all
# yum makecache # yum install salt-master 服务端master
# yum install salt-minion 客户端minion
# yum install salt-ssh ssh远程执行命令
# yum install salt-syndic 类似代理
# yum install salt-cloud 用来配置云服务
2. 加入开机自启动,并启动服务。
# chkconfig salt-master on
# service salt-master start #主程序监听两个端口
: 消息发布端口
: 客户端与服务端通信端口
二. minion
1. 与步骤1类似,只需要安装minion即可,以守护进程方式启动。
# yum install salt-minion
2 # chkconfig salt-minion on
3 # service salt-minion start
2. 客户端配置
# vim /etc/salt/minion
修改master字段为服务端IP地址,如下:
master: 10.1.21.225 #注意冒号后必须有一个空格,IP为master主机地址
# service salt-minion restart #重启
三. 测试
# salt-key -L #master上执行查看未接受的key已经出现minion主机
# salt-key -A -y #所有机器通过授权
# slat-key -L #再次查看已成为授权Accepted Keys
# # salt "*" test.ping #测试返回True即可。
SaltStack安装部署的更多相关文章
- saltStack 安装部署
		
1.saltStack 服务架构介绍 SaltStack 是一种基于C/S架构的服务模式,在SaltStack架构中服务器端叫作Master,客户端叫作Minion,传统C/S架构为:客户端发送请求给 ...
 - saltstack安装部署以及简单实用
		
一,saltstack简介: SaltStack是一种新的基础设施管理方法开发软件,简单易部署,可伸缩的足以管理成千上万的服务器,和足够快的速度控制,与他们交流,以毫秒为单位. SaltSta ...
 - 超详细saltstack安装部署及应用
		
1.环境准备 准备两台虚拟机 主机名 ip role linux-node1 10.0.0.7 master linux-node2 10.0.0.8 minion 在节点1上安装 master 和 ...
 - SaltStack安装篇
		
一.基础介绍1.简介 salt 是一个基础平台管理工具 salt是一个配置管理系统,能够维护预定于状态的远程节点 salt是一个分布式远程执行系统,用来在远程节点上执行命令和查询数据 2.salt的核 ...
 - 使用saltstack批量部署服务器运行环境事例——批量部署nagios客户端
		
之前关于搭建web服务器集群实验的这篇文章http://www.cnblogs.com/cjyfff/p/3553579.html中,关于如何用saltstack批量部署服务器这一点当时没有记录到文章 ...
 - Ansible安装部署以及常用模块详解
		
一. Ansible 介绍Ansible是一个配置管理系统configuration management system, python 语言是运维人员必须会的语言, ansible 是一个基于py ...
 - linux下安装部署ansible
		
linux下安装部署ansible 介绍 Ansible是一种批量部署工具,现在运维人员用的最多的三种开源集中化管理工具有:puppet,saltstack,ansible,各有各的优缺点,其中sal ...
 - redis常用服务安装部署
		
常用服务安装部署 学了前面的Linux基础,想必童鞋们是不是更感兴趣了?接下来就学习常用服务部署吧! 安装环境: centos7 + vmware + xshell 即将登场的是: mysql(m ...
 - 基于saltstack自动化部署高可用kubernetes集群
		
SaltStack自动化部署HA-Kubernetes 本项目在GitHub上,会不定期更新,大家也可以提交ISSUE,地址为:https://github.com/skymyyang/salt-k8 ...
 
随机推荐
- HDU 5936 Difference ( 2016 CCPC 杭州 D && 折半枚举 )
			
题目链接 题意 : 给出一个 x 和 k 问有多少个 y 使得 x = f(y, k) - y .f(y, k) 为 y 中每个位的数的 k 次方之和.x ≥ 0 分析 : f(y, k) - y = ...
 - HDOJ 4858  项目管理    (  只是有点 莫队的分块思想在里面而已啦  )
			
题目: 链接:http://acm.hdu.edu.cn/showproblem.php?pid=4858 题意: 我们建造了一个大项目!这个项目有n个节点,用很多边连接起来,并且这个项目是连通的! ...
 - 路由器配置——RIP路由
			
一.实验目的:用rip路由实现全网互通 二.拓扑图: 三.具体步骤配置 (1)R1路由器配置 Router>enable --进入特权模式Router#configure terminal ...
 - 网络层中的 IP 协议
			
IP协议 IP(IPv4.IPv6)相当于 OSI 参考模型中的第3层——网络层.网络层的主要作用是“实现终端节点之间的通信”.这种终端节点之间的通信也叫“点对点通信”. 网络的下一层——数据链路层的 ...
 - APScheduler 3.0.1浅析
			
简介 APScheduler是一个小巧而强大的Python类库,通过它你可以实现类似Unix系统cronjob类似的定时任务系统.使用之余,阅读一下源码,一方面有助于更好的使用它,另一方面,个人认为a ...
 - linux服务之memcached
			
http://www.runoob.com/memcached/memcached-cas.html https://github.com/memcached/memcached/blob/maste ...
 - Android之MVVM开发模式
			
MVVM 模式简介 MVVM模式是指Model-View-ViewModel.相信看过笔者关于MVP的文章的读者也会发现,无论如何抽象化,在我们的View层中是无法避免的要处理一部分逻辑的.而MVVM ...
 - jQuery常用Event-API
			
目的:对web页面(HTML/JSP)进行事件触发,完成特殊效果的处理 window.onload:在浏览器加载web页面时触发,可以写多次onload事件,但后者覆盖前者 ready:在浏览器加载w ...
 - Ubuntu16.04格式化U盘
			
root@ubuntu:~# fdisk -l root@ubuntu:~# fdisk /dev/sdb 格式化U盘: root@ubuntu:~# fdisk -l sudo mkfs.ntfs ...
 - Spring Boot AOP Demo
			
什么是AOP? AOP面向切面,切面将那些与业务无关,却被业务模块共同调用的逻辑提取并封装起来,减少了系统中的重复代码,降低了模块间的耦合度,同时提高了系统的可维护性. 实现策略JAVA SE动态代理 ...